The Billing Analyst will work with individual billing departments in order to maintain accuracy and efficiency for receivables. This individual will monitor billable items to confirm we are operating at a benchmark profit and ensure proper procedures are being followed when it comes to customer setup.

Key Responsibilities:

- Create invoices, transmit file to print vendors and post billing transactions
- Compile, validate and maintain generated revenue reports
- Process customer refund request
- Researche, resolve and manage customer credit balance reports
- Revenue reporting and month-end system close processing
- Maintain and review bill cycles
- Monitor company billing system for proper account set-up and activity flow
- Monitor customer accounts for irregularities
- Research and resolve billing discrepancies and provide backups to customers
- Monitor and support billing adjustment Requirements:

- Respond to customer questions and requests
- Assist finance with revenue reporting queries
- Perform account reconciliations
- Ensure coordination with other departments, clarify roles and responsibilities for resolving service issues
- Work with routing specialists to optimize routes
- Effectively deal with large commercial contracts/clients
- Photocopy and collate documents for distribution, mailing and filing
- Prepare documentation to assist Accounts Receivable/Payable (Invoices, Purchase Orders) etc
- Evaluate current operating procedures and provide recommendations to improve efficiency and accuracy
- Implement new standard procedures companywide for the organization
